Noun[edit]

Apfelschorle f (genitive Apfelschorle, plural Apfelschorlen)

  1. a drink made of apple juice and carbonated water, mixed roughly half and half; one of the most popular non-alcoholic beverages in German-speaking Europe
    Synonym: Apfelsaftschorle
